All successful fundraising campaigns start with an informed, strategic, and comprehensive plan. If you are wondering if it is time for your organization to launch a major fundraising campaign, a feasibility study is the place to start. We work with organizations to build their strategic vision, develop a case for support, advise on financial goals, gather information from internal and external stakeholders, and create a report with observations and recommendations that will serve as a roadmap for your campaign.

A strong annual fund is the foundation of any successful fundraising program. Focusing on growing your annual fund is critical to having a diverse and sustainable donor base, ensuring your organization’s ability to be flexible and nimble during times of change.
We can work with you to take a deep dive into your annual fund program elements–direct mail, email and other digital solicitations, events, messaging and collateral, acknowledgement process, tracking and metrics–and offer expert guidance and recommendations to help make your annual fund stronger, more dynamic, and reliable for the future.
